Abstract
Reactivity of proteinase 3 (PR3) was tested against various amino acid and thioester substrates. The best substrate is Boc-Ala-Ala-Nva-SBzl with a kcat/Km value of 1.0 x 10(6) M-1.s-1. We also studied the effect of C-ANCA on PR3 proteolytic activity towards elastin and inactivation by alpha 1-antitrypsin (alpha 1AT). C-ANCA IgG from 8 patients with active Wegener's granulomatosis were tested and found to inhibit elastin degradation by PR3 and to prevent the inactivation of PR3 by alpha 1AT.
